Carrier Bearing (center support bearing)

Where can a man find one of these half reasonably priced? My dealer wanted $110 and Autozone/Advance don't sell the right one. All the ones they have aren't what I need.

I got one from CarQuest for 30 bucks. Just measure your inner bearing and ask for one for a Chevy P30. Have to make a little plate for it but then they are all universal after that.

You can get the cheap one, take the bracket apart, and put the new bearing and damper in your old bracket. It's not very hard.
